Output ffd04735ade7494c621c7d5c12c90eaddb78a948912502578339bd61b8f03fc9:3

value
99573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6625f7b11b4836d67988298bec721b7cf2c49b2 OP_EQUAL
address
3NhBBjo4TRVdhiyP92TVLMqeujMSajjUMf
transaction
ffd04735ade7494c621c7d5c12c90eaddb78a948912502578339bd61b8f03fc9
confirmations
298119
spent
true